How the estimate works
This calculator estimates cubic volume from the item counts you enter: furniture, appliances, boxes, and miscellaneous storage items. It then adds a 30% packing buffer and compares the result to real truck thresholds for 10 ft, 15 ft, 20 ft, and 26 ft sizes.
What to verify before booking
Confirm interior dimensions, door openings, weight limits, towing rules, and provider-specific equipment. The bedroom selector is only a sanity check, not the main recommendation driver, and the final fit still depends on the actual items in the load.
FAQ
How accurate is a moving truck size calculator?
A truck size calculator is a planning estimate, not a guarantee. It can help narrow the right truck size, but you should still verify dimensions, weight limits, clearances, and rental details before booking.
What information should I enter into a truck size calculator?
Start with bedrooms, large furniture, appliances, and box count. The more specific your item list is, the more useful the estimate becomes.
Are truck and storage dimensions always the same?
No. Dimensions can vary by provider, equipment, location, and door opening. Use these pages for planning and confirm final measurements before renting.
